About the role

As Maintenance Team Leader at Reckitt’s Nottingham site, you will be responsible for overseeing all manufacturing maintenance activities within your area. Leading a team of 5–8 multi-skilled technicians and engineers, you will ensure equipment is maintained to GMP standards, supporting safety, reliability, and continuous improvement.

Your responsibilities
  • Be responsible for all Manufacturing Maintenance activities within their area of responsibility
  • Have direct reports of 5 – 8 Shift Technicians & Asset Care Engineers, across mechanical, electrical or multi-skilled disciplines
  • Have the following as key points of contact: Asset Care Manager, Site Engineering Manager, Facilities Manager, Electrical Manager, EHS Manager, Technical Project Manager, Operations Managers, Product Supply Leaders, Quality management, external suppliers and contractors
  • Be responsible for ensuring all items of plant and equipment are maintained to the appropriate standard to ensure their performance is safe, reliable and in accordance with the principles of Good Manufacturing Practice whilst continually improving performance, plant and systems to support the development of the Manufacturing Facilities and contributing to the Supply function meeting its customer service, quality and cost targets.
